People Who Shape Our World: Nanako Umemoto

  • May 19, 2007 | 2 pm–3 pm

Born in Kyoto, Japan, Nanako Umemoto has been practicing architecture with Jesse Reiser in New York City since 1996. Reiser + Umemoto is an internationally recognized architecture firm that has built projects at a wide range of scales: furniture design, residential and commercial sculptures, and landscape design and infrastructure.
